Mornflake Pinhead Oatmeal — High-Energy Dehusked Oatmeal for Wild & Cage Birds

Mornflake Pinhead Oatmeal is a high-energy cereal with the husk removed and chopped into small pieces, making it accessible to a broad range of bird species. Soft, easily digestible and highly nutritious, pinhead oatmeal is particularly valuable during cold weather when birds need extra energy, and during the breeding season when parent birds need easily portable food for nestlings. How to Feed

Offer on a bird table, ground feeder or in an open dish. Can also be mixed into soft food blends for cage and aviary birds. Particularly useful during the breeding season as a soft, safe food for parent birds to carry to nestlings. Store in a cool, dry place.

Suitable for attracting

Robin, blackbird, song thrush, dunnock, wren, starling, house sparrow and many more ground-feeding and soft-food-eating garden birds. Also suitable for canaries, finches and other cage and aviary birds.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is pinhead oatmeal?
Pinhead oatmeal is whole oat groats (dehusked oats) that have been cut into small pieces. Removing the husk makes the oat soft and digestible for birds, while cutting it into small pieces makes it accessible to a wider range of species including small birds.

Is pinhead oatmeal safe for nestlings?
Yes — pinhead oatmeal is one of the safest foods to put out during the breeding season. It is soft, small and easily digestible, making it safe for parent birds to carry to nestlings in the nest.

Can I use this for cage birds?
Yes — pinhead oatmeal is suitable for canaries, finches and other cage and aviary birds as part of a varied diet or mixed into soft food.
